George Stepney, 1663-1707: Diplomat and PoetJ. Clarke & Company, 1997 - 403 Seiten The first full-length biography of one of the most significant literary and diplomatic figures of the late 17th century. The fruit of over ten years of study, this work provides new and valuable material on a key period of political and military history. |
